diff options
author | Or Gerlitz | 2018-02-15 11:39:55 +0100 |
---|---|---|
committer | Saeed Mahameed | 2018-03-26 22:58:15 +0200 |
commit | f125376b06bcc57dfb0216ac8d6ec6d5dcf81025 (patch) | |
tree | 63c1ad7d36d691a764a5e56b92beaa8192270d33 /drivers/net/ethernet/mellanox/mlx5/core/Kconfig | |
parent | net/mlx5e: Use 32 bits to store VF representor SQ number (diff) | |
download | kernel-qcow2-linux-f125376b06bcc57dfb0216ac8d6ec6d5dcf81025.tar.gz kernel-qcow2-linux-f125376b06bcc57dfb0216ac8d6ec6d5dcf81025.tar.xz kernel-qcow2-linux-f125376b06bcc57dfb0216ac8d6ec6d5dcf81025.zip |
net/mlx5: Make eswitch support to depend on switchdev
Add dependancy for switchdev to be congfigured as any user-space control
plane SW is expected to use the HW switchdev ID to locate the representors
related to VFs of a certain PF and apply SW/offloaded switching on them.
Fixes: e80541ecabd5 ('net/mlx5: Add CONFIG_MLX5_ESWITCH Kconfig')
Signed-off-by: Or Gerlitz <ogerlitz@mellanox.com>
Reviewed-by: Mark Bloch <markb@mellanox.com>
Signed-off-by: Saeed Mahameed <saeedm@mellanox.com>
Diffstat (limited to 'drivers/net/ethernet/mellanox/mlx5/core/Kconfig')
-rw-r--r-- | drivers/net/ethernet/mellanox/mlx5/core/Kconfig |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/ethernet/mellanox/mlx5/core/Kconfig b/drivers/net/ethernet/mellanox/mlx5/core/Kconfig index 25deaa5a534c..c032319f1cb9 100644 --- a/drivers/net/ethernet/mellanox/mlx5/core/Kconfig +++ b/drivers/net/ethernet/mellanox/mlx5/core/Kconfig @@ -46,7 +46,7 @@ config MLX5_MPFS config MLX5_ESWITCH bool "Mellanox Technologies MLX5 SRIOV E-Switch support" - depends on MLX5_CORE_EN + depends on MLX5_CORE_EN && NET_SWITCHDEV default y ---help--- Mellanox Technologies Ethernet SRIOV E-Switch support in ConnectX NIC. |